INCI Name: Capryloyl Glycine
CAS Number: 14246-53-8
EC Number: 238-122-3
Chemical Name: N-Octanoylglycine
Molecular Formula: C10H19NO3
Molecular Weight: 201.26 g/mol
Capryloyl glycine is an amino acid-derived ingredient commonly used in personal care products to support preservation systems and enhance overall formulation performance. It is classified as a multifunctional ingredient, offering antimicrobial and skin-conditioning benefits, as well as anti-acne properties by controlling sebum production. It is paraben-free and formaldehyde-free.
Capryloyl glycine disrupts microbial cell membranes while remaining gentle on skin. It is often used alongside emulsifiers and solubilizers, such as polysorbate 20, to optimize stability and performance.

Capryloyl glycine is widely used in personal care products due to its multifunctional profile.
In cosmetic formulations, capryloyl glycine is used alongside other hair and skincare ingredients to enhance product stability and overall performance. Common applications include:
Facial cleansers and washes
Moisturizers and emulsions
Serums and treatment products
Color cosmetics, including foundations and lip products that require broad-spectrum protection
Hair care products such as shampoos and conditioners
Gentle baby care products
Typical use levels vary depending on formulation goals and system design, but many applications fall within the 0.1% to 2.0% range outlined in supplier guidance.

Proper storage helps preserve material integrity and ensures consistent performance over time.
Store in a tightly sealed container in its original packaging
Keep at or below room temperature
Protect from moisture and strong oxidizing agents
Blanket in nitrogen when part load is removed
Shelf life: 3 years from the manufacture date when properly stored
When handling capryloyl glycine:
Use appropriate personal protective equipment (PPE), including gloves and safety glasses
Avoid inhalation of dust during handling
Ensure adequate ventilation in processing environments
First aid guidance:
Eye contact: Rinse thoroughly with water for 15 minutes and seek medical attention if irritation persists
Skin contact: Wash with soap and water
Ingestion: Rinse mouth and seek medical care if needed

Capryloyl glycine is typically used as part of a broader preservation strategy rather than as a direct one-to-one replacement for traditional preservatives. It can help support antimicrobial performance while aligning with paraben-free formulation requirements.
Typical use levels for capryloyl glycine in hair and skin products range from 0.1% to 2.0%, depending on the formulation type and desired performance. Final concentration should always be determined through stability and challenge testing to ensure optimal results.

Capryloyl glycine is a synthetically produced ingredient created through the reaction of caprylic acid derivatives with glycine. It mimics naturally occurring fatty acid–amino acid compounds.
